Soap veteran, Lindsay Korman-Hartley is making her way back to daytime soap operas. She has been starring in and writing/directing a bunch of Lifetime movies but she’s temporarily stepping into the role of Sam McCall for Kelly Monaco on General Hospital. In regards to this, she said, “some big shoes to fill…precious too. I hope you enjoy watching Sam as much as I have enjoyed playing her, temporarily“.


Hartley got her kickstart in soaps back in 1999 when she started playing the role of Theresa Lopez-Fitzgerald on Passions. When the show was canceled she went over to Days of Our Lives and reunited with a number of her Passions co-stars this time playing Arianna Hernandez. After her character was killed off, she stepped in the role of Cara Castillo on All My Children and stayed with the show throughout its cancellation and Prospect Park reboot.


Fans wanted her back on soaps someway somehow and there were even rumors that she auditioned for the role of Mia Rosales on The Young and the Restless. Now, comes news that she will be joining GH temporarily and in soapland reuniting with her real-life bestie, Brook Kerr (Portia Robinson).


Hartley makes her debut in August.
